日期:2014-05-16 浏览次数:20540 次
很久没用Oracle了,快一年了吧!没动不代表真的就全忘了,哈哈。。。
?
昨天看代码,神奇的发现,居然是从一个Oracle的数据库中,同步数据过来。我天哪,这一个系统中,用到了至少3种数据库啊。。。本身用的是MySql,上次发现,同步一些数据,是从一个SqlServer数据库过来的,而这次,又惊现Oracle。。。
?
在这台机子上,很少会用到Oracle,估计用完了这次,还不知道有没有下次,所以,不想安装。昨天就没弄。
?
今天把移动硬盘带过来了,先把它搞好。一路很顺利,也记录一下。
?
1、拿到绿色安装包。我这里有,不过太大,40M,JavaEye目前只支持到10M,传不上来。如果需要,可以联系我。其实,就是Oracle安装目录里面的一些文件,把它们拷出来,放到一个单独的目录。为了以后使用方便,这些文件打成了一个包。里面的文件有:
?
E:\OracleClient>dir 驱动器 E 中的卷是 soft 卷的序列号是 D087-2CD8 E:\OracleClient 的目录 2011-04-22 10:24 <DIR> . 2011-04-22 10:24 <DIR> .. 2008-10-01 04:00 14,848 adrci.exe 2008-10-01 04:00 4,106 adrci.sym 2008-10-01 04:01 315 BASIC_README 2008-10-01 04:00 30,720 genezi.exe 2008-10-01 04:00 13,742 genezi.sym 2008-09-30 20:57 1,060,864 mfc71.dll 2008-09-30 20:57 348,160 msvcr71.dll 2008-10-01 03:22 520,192 oci.dll 2008-10-01 03:22 248,665 oci.sym 2008-09-18 13:48 77,824 ocijdbc11.dll 2008-09-18 13:48 13,143 ocijdbc11.sym 2008-10-01 02:56 352,256 ociw32.dll 2008-10-01 02:56 39,007 ociw32.sym 2008-09-18 13:49 1,890,262 ojdbc5.jar 2008-09-18 13:49 1,988,193 ojdbc6.jar 2008-09-18 21:47 1,130,496 orannzsbb11.dll 2008-09-18 21:47 203,703 orannzsbb11.sym 2008-10-01 02:48 868,352 oraocci11.dll 2008-10-01 04:00 258,671 oraocci11.sym 2008-10-01 03:45 117,604,352 oraociei11.dll 2008-10-01 03:45 3,804,566 oraociei11.sym 2008-10-01 04:00 831,488 orasql11.dll 2008-10-01 04:00 18,188 orasql11.sym 2011-04-22 10:14 586 tnsnames.ora 2008-10-01 04:01 <DIR> vc71 2008-10-01 04:01 <DIR> vc8 24 个文件 131,322,699 字节 4 个目录 5,926,625,280 可用字节 E:\OracleClient>dir vc71 驱动器 E 中的卷是 soft 卷的序列号是 D087-2CD8 E:\OracleClient\vc71 的目录 2008-10-01 04:01 <DIR> . 2008-10-01 04:01 <DIR> .. 2008-10-01 02:48 868,352 oraocci11.dll 2008-10-01 04:00 258,671 oraocci11.sym 2 个文件 1,127,023 字节 2 个目录 5,926,617,088 可用字节 E:\OracleClient>dir vc8 驱动器 E 中的卷是 soft 卷的序列号是 D087-2CD8 E:\OracleClient\vc8 的目录 2008-10-01 04:01 <DIR> . 2008-10-01 04:01 <DIR> .. 2008-10-01 01:29 569,344 oraocci11.dll 2008-10-01 01:29 380 oraocci11.dll.manifest 2008-10-01 04:00 446,633 oraocci11.sym 3 个文件 1,016,357 字节 2 个目录 5,926,617,088 可用字节
?
2、配置环境变量:
?
1、ORACLE_HOME:E:\OracleClient 2、TNS_ADMIN:E:\OracleClient(这个指的是tnsnames.ora文件的目录) 3、NLS_LANG:SIMPLIFIED CHINESE_CHINA.ZHS16GBK 4、Path:加入E:\OracleClient?
3、修改tnsnames.ora文件。这个根据具体Server来配置。如果需要联多个Server,下面的代码,就多重复几次:
DBNAME =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521)) (CONNECT_DATA = (SERVER = ServerName) (SERVICE_NAME = ServiceName) ) )
?
4、安装PlSql,启动,输入用户名,密码,一切OK。
?
?